Frequently asked questions (FAQs)

Why would an establishment need a Silipaktor™ if it already has a compactor?
Putting glass into a general waste compactor means reducing its efficiency by as much as half. Ordinary compactors are not designed to crush glass and the glass itself can be a robust material when surrounded by, for example, paper and cardboard. The Silipaktor™ glass-crusher enables an existing compactor to operate more efficiently, reducing general waste costs and enabling useful resources to be recycled.

What is to stop the Silipaktor™ spraying bits of glass everywhere?
The machine only works when the bin is in place - an automatic cutout activates if it is removed. The Silipaktor™ meets all relevant EU legislation and is CE marked.

How many people does it take to use it?
The Silipaktor™ is designed for one-person operation. The bins can be moved easily and lifted using standard equipment.

What sort of access is necessary?
GCS recommends a service lift or reasonably flat walkway because of the weight of the bins. The equipment is not suitable for use on stairs.

How much does it cost and what is the lead time?
The price of each Silipaktor™ unit varies according to the estimated throughput. Delivery time in the UK from placement of the order is in the region of eight to ten weeks. A finance facility is also offered for premises that prefer to lease the equipment.
